Maisonelle: The Handwritten Script Font for Elegant Design

Capturing the Beauty of Authentic Signature Writing

When you're working on a project that needs to feel personal, intimate, and genuinely sophisticated, the typeface you choose does more than convey words. It sets a mood, communicates values, and tells a story before anyone reads a single sentence. That's where a premium font like Maisonelle enters the conversation. This isn't just another script typeface sitting in your design assets folder. Maisonelle is a graceful handwritten font that captures the beauty of authentic signature writing, complete with flowing strokes, delicate curves, and those subtle natural imperfections that make handwriting feel real.

What makes Maisonelle stand out in a crowded market of script fonts is its balance. Too many script font options swing wildly between overly polished calligraphy that feels sterile and rough hand-lettered styles that sacrifice readability. Maisonelle sits in a refined middle ground. Its strokes have a smooth rhythm that feels effortless, yet there's enough variation and organic character to give it genuine warmth. The curves flow naturally, the letter connections feel intuitive, and the overall texture avoids the mechanical uniformity that plagues so many digital typefaces.

This creative font carries a personality that's both intimate and polished. It reads like something written by someone with beautiful penmanship who isn't trying too hard. That quality alone makes it incredibly versatile across different contexts, from high-end brand identity work to personal creative projects where authenticity matters.

Where Maisonelle Truly Shines in Real Projects

Understanding where a font performs best is just as important as appreciating its aesthetic qualities. Maisonelle's elegant character makes it a natural fit for specific types of work, and knowing these applications helps you decide whether it belongs in your current project.

Luxury branding and logo design benefit enormously from Maisonelle's refined handwritten feel. If you're developing a brand identity for a boutique hotel, a high-end cosmetics line, a bespoke jewelry maker, or a premium lifestyle brand, this typeface communicates exclusivity without pretension. The flowing strokes suggest craftsmanship and attention to detail, qualities that resonate with audiences who value quality over quantity. For logo design, Maisonelle works beautifully as a primary wordmark or as a complementary element paired with a clean sans serif font for supporting text.

Wedding invitations and stationery represent another natural home for this font. The delicate curves and personal touch of Maisonelle evoke the elegance of handwritten correspondence. Stationery designers, wedding planners, and couples planning their own invitations will find that this typeface brings a sophistication that feels genuine rather than decorative. It pairs well with both classic serif font options for formal invitations and minimal sans serif typefaces for modern designs.

In editorial design, Maisonelle adds visual interest to layouts that might otherwise feel flat. Magazine headlines, pull quotes, chapter openers, and feature titles all benefit from the dynamic quality of a well-crafted display font. The key here is restraint. Using Maisonelle for select typographic moments while relying on a more neutral body text font creates a visual hierarchy that guides readers through the page naturally.

Packaging design for beauty products, artisanal foods, and specialty goods is another area where this font excels. The handwritten quality suggests small-batch production, careful sourcing, and human craftsmanship. When consumers are choosing between products on a shelf, the typography on the packaging influences perception in milliseconds. Maisonelle communicates premium quality and personal care, which can be the deciding factor for discerning buyers.

Digital applications deserve attention too. Social media graphics, photography watermarks, blog headers, and web design accents all benefit from the warmth and personality that Maisonelle brings. Content creators and bloggers who want to establish a consistent visual voice across their platforms will find that this typeface adds a recognizable signature quality to their work. It performs well in social media graphics where scroll-stopping visual impact matters, particularly for quotes, announcements, and branded content.

How the Right Script Font Influences Perception and Engagement

Typography does psychological work that most people never consciously notice. The typefaces you choose influence how audiences perceive your brand, how they engage with your content, and whether they remember you later. A handwritten font like Maisonelle taps into deeply human associations with authenticity, personal attention, and care.

When someone encounters Maisonelle in a brand context, the flowing script suggests that a real person is behind the business. This is particularly valuable for entrepreneurs and small business owners building brands in competitive markets. In a landscape dominated by generic templates and overused typefaces, a distinctive script font helps establish recognition and recall. Your audience may not consciously identify the font, but they'll associate its visual qualities with your brand over time.

Visual hierarchy benefits from strategic use of Maisonelle as well. In any layout, whether it's a website, a brochure, or a social media post, you need contrast between different levels of information. Using Maisonelle for headlines or accent text while setting body copy in a readable serif or sans serif font creates clear differentiation. This approach helps readers scan content efficiently while still experiencing the personality and warmth that Maisonelle provides.

Brand consistency across touchpoints is another consideration. A commercial font like Maisonelle that works across multiple applications, from print to digital, from formal to casual, makes it easier to maintain a cohesive visual identity. You can use it on your business cards, your website headers, your email signatures, your product packaging, and your social media presence without it feeling out of place in any context.

Practical Guidance for Choosing and Using Maisonelle

Before committing to any typeface for a project, it's worth evaluating fit carefully. Start by considering the tone and audience of your work. Maisonelle is elegant and personal, which makes it ideal for projects targeting adults who appreciate sophistication and authenticity. It may not be the right choice for projects requiring a more utilitarian, technical, or playful tone. Knowing when not to use a font is just as valuable as knowing when to use it.

Font pairing is where many designers struggle, and it's worth investing time here. Maisonelle pairs well with clean, geometric sans serif font families for modern compositions. Think of typefaces with open letterforms and generous spacing that provide contrast without competing for attention. Classic serif font options also work beautifully, particularly for formal or editorial contexts where a traditional aesthetic is appropriate. Avoid pairing Maisonelle with other decorative or script fonts, as this creates visual noise rather than harmony.

Review the included styles and character sets before you begin designing. Many modern typography packages include alternate characters, ligatures, and stylistic variations that expand your creative options. Understanding what's available ensures you're getting the most from the typeface and can make informed decisions about letter combinations and overall composition.

Readability deserves careful attention with any script or display font. Maisonelle is designed for headlines, accents, and short text passages rather than extended body copy. Using it at appropriate sizes, typically larger sizes where its flowing strokes and delicate details remain legible, preserves its impact. For longer text, pair it with a highly readable body font that complements its personality without mimicking its style.

Licensing is a practical consideration that matters for commercial work. If you're using Maisonelle for client projects, product packaging, or any commercial application, confirm that the licensing terms cover your intended use. Most quality commercial font licenses are straightforward, but reviewing the terms upfront prevents complications later.

Finally, test Maisonelle in context before finalizing your design. Set it alongside your other design elements, view it at the sizes you'll actually use, and evaluate how it feels within the overall composition. A font that looks beautiful in isolation may need adjustment in context, and that's a normal part of the design process. The goal is always a cohesive whole where every element, including your typography, works together to communicate your message effectively.
